Suggest a better descriptionCream sugar, brown sugar & margarine. Add vanilla & egg white. Stir in flour, baking soda & salt. Stir in chips. Drop by rounded teaspoon onto a greased cookie sheet sprayed with Pam. Bake 375 for 8 - 10 min. Cool slightly; then remove from sheet. NOTES : 2 tbsp egg substitute can be used instead of the egg white.
